MySQL é a plataforma de gerenciamento de banco de dados relacional mais popular, gratuita e de código aberto, que é usada para hospedar vários bancos de dados em um único servidor, permitindo acesso multiusuário a cada banco de dados.
O mais recente MySQL 8.0 versão está disponível para instalação a partir do padrão AppStream repositório usando o módulo MySQL que é habilitado por padrão no CentOS 8 e RHEL 8 sistemas.
Há também o MariaDB 10.3 a versão do banco de dados está disponível para instalação a partir do padrão AppStream repositório, que é “substituição imediata ” para MySQL 5.7 , com algumas restrições. Se seu aplicativo não for compatível com MySQL 8.0 , então eu recomendo que você instale o MariaDB 10.3.
Neste artigo, mostraremos o processo de instalação do MySQL 8.0 mais recente versão no CentOS 8 e RHEL 8 usando o padrão AppStream repositório através do utilitário YUM.
Observação :As instruções fornecidas neste artigo só funcionarão se você tiver habilitado a assinatura Red Hat no RHEL 8.
Instale o MySQL 8.0 no CentOS8 e RHEL 8
A versão mais recente do MySQL 8.0 está disponível para instalação a partir do Application Stream padrão repositório no CentOS 8 e RHEL 8 sistemas usando o seguinte comando yum.
# yum -y install @mysql
O
@mysql
O módulo instalará a versão mais recente do MySQL com todas as dependências. Uma vez que a instalação do MySQL for concluído, inicie o serviço MySQL, habilite-o para iniciar automaticamente na inicialização do sistema e verifique o status executando os comandos a seguir.
# systemctl start mysqld # systemctl enable --now mysqld # systemctl status mysqld
Agora proteja o MySQL instalação executando o script de segurança que carrega várias operações baseadas em segurança, como definir a senha do root, remover usuários anônimos, impedir o login do root remotamente, remover o banco de dados de teste e recarregar o privilégio.
# mysql_secure_installation
Uma vez que MySQL a instalação é segura, você pode fazer login no shell do MySQL e começar a criar novos bancos de dados e usuários.
# mysql -u root -p mysql> create database tecmint; mysql> GRANT ALL ON tecmint.* TO [email protected] IDENTIFIED BY 'ravi123'; mysql> exit
Isso é tudo! Neste artigo, explicamos como instalar o MySQL 8.0 no CentOS 8 e RHEL 8 . Se você tiver alguma dúvida ou feedback, compartilhe conosco na seção de comentários abaixo.